src/libero@cli.erl

-module(libero@cli).
-compile([no_auto_import, nowarn_unused_vars, nowarn_unused_function, nowarn_nomatch, inline]).
-define(FILEPATH, "src/libero/cli.gleam").
-export([parse_args/1, parse_command/0]).
-export_type([database/0, command/0]).
-if(?OTP_RELEASE >= 27).
-define(MODULEDOC(Str), -moduledoc(Str)).
-define(DOC(Str), -doc(Str)).
-else.
-define(MODULEDOC(Str), -compile([])).
-define(DOC(Str), -compile([])).
-endif.
?MODULEDOC(
" CLI command router for the Libero framework.\n"
"\n"
" Usage: gleam run -m libero -- <command> [args]\n"
" Commands: new, add, gen, build\n"
).
-type database() :: postgres | sqlite.
-type command() :: {new, binary(), gleam@option:option(database())} |
{add, binary(), binary()} |
gen |
build |
unknown.
-file("src/libero/cli.gleam", 94).
-spec parse_database(binary()) -> {ok, database()} | {error, nil}.
parse_database(Value) ->
case Value of
<<"pg"/utf8>> ->
{ok, postgres};
<<"sqlite"/utf8>> ->
{ok, sqlite};
_ ->
{error, nil}
end.
-file("src/libero/cli.gleam", 30).
?DOC(
" Parse a list of argument strings into a Command.\n"
" Separated from parse_command so tests can call it without argv.\n"
).
-spec parse_args(list(binary())) -> command().
parse_args(Args) ->
case Args of
[<<"new"/utf8>>, Name, <<"--database"/utf8>>, Db | _] ->
case parse_database(Db) of
{ok, Database} ->
{new, Name, {some, Database}};
{error, nil} ->
gleam_stdlib:println_error(
<<<<"error: Invalid database: `"/utf8, Db/binary>>/binary,
"`
\x{2502}
\x{2502} --database must be \"pg\" or \"sqlite\"
\x{2502}
hint: gleam run -m libero -- new my_app --database pg"/utf8>>
),
unknown
end;
[<<"new"/utf8>>, _, <<"--database"/utf8>>] ->
gleam_stdlib:println_error(
<<"error: Missing database value
\x{2502}
\x{2502} --database requires a value
\x{2502}
hint: gleam run -m libero -- new my_app --database pg
gleam run -m libero -- new my_app --database sqlite"/utf8>>
),
unknown;
[<<"new"/utf8>>, Name@1 | _] ->
{new, Name@1, none};
[<<"add"/utf8>>, Name@2, <<"--target"/utf8>>, Target | _] ->
case Target of
<<"javascript"/utf8>> ->
{add, Name@2, Target};
<<"erlang"/utf8>> ->
{add, Name@2, Target};
_ ->
gleam_stdlib:println_error(
<<<<<<<<"error: Invalid target: `"/utf8, Target/binary>>/binary,
"`
\x{2502}
\x{2502} --target must be \"javascript\" or \"erlang\"
\x{2502}
hint: gleam run -m libero -- add "/utf8>>/binary,
Name@2/binary>>/binary,
" --target javascript"/utf8>>
),
unknown
end;
[<<"add"/utf8>>, _ | _] ->
gleam_stdlib:println_error(
<<"error: Missing --target flag
\x{2502}
\x{2502} The add command requires a target
\x{2502}
hint: gleam run -m libero -- add <name> --target javascript"/utf8>>
),
unknown;
[<<"gen"/utf8>> | _] ->
gen;
[<<"build"/utf8>> | _] ->
build;
[<<"new"/utf8>>] ->
gleam_stdlib:println_error(
<<"error: Missing project name
\x{2502}
\x{2502} The new command requires a project name
\x{2502}
hint: gleam run -m libero -- new my_app"/utf8>>
),
unknown;
_ ->
unknown
end.
-file("src/libero/cli.gleam", 24).
?DOC(" Parse CLI arguments into a Command.\n").
-spec parse_command() -> command().
parse_command() ->
parse_args(erlang:element(4, argv:load())).
